As a Property Manager, you will play a vital role in managing and maintaining our self-storage facility while providing exceptional customer service and property upkeep. Key Responsibilities: Customer Service: Build strong relationships with customers by identifying their self-storage needs and offering tailored solutions while delivering exceptional service. Engage with customers face-to-face, creating a welcoming environment. Achieve monthly sales goals and metrics. Conduct regular property walks to perform lock checks and showcase available units to potential customers. Work independently and collaboratively to rent self-storage spaces, sell merchandise, manage leasing activities, accept payments through our POS system, and complete daily bank deposits. Handle invoice reviews and approvals efficiently within our database. Process invoices, manage reports, and oversee the legal procedures related to auctions. Manage the store's budget for expenses while ensuring adequate supply and inventory levels. Property Maintenance: Perform daily walks of the property, engage in cleaning duties, and assist in managing physical upkeep (including lifting up to 50 lbs). Maintain the facility's cleanliness including mopping, sweeping, changing lightbulbs, and clearing out units. Ensure the overall condition of the property meets company standards, focusing on cleanliness and safety.
